Management Commentary
During the accompanying the previous quarter earnings call, SPRY leadership centered discussions on progress across the company’s product pipeline, with a particular focus on its lead candidate under regulatory review by U.S. health authorities. Management noted that the quarterly operating loss fell within internal budget projections, highlighting that cost-control measures implemented in recent months have helped keep cash burn rates in line with planned targets. Leadership also confirmed that the company’s current cash reserves are sufficient to fund planned operational activities through the next 12 to 18 months, eliminating near-term concerns about potential dilutive financing for existing shareholders, according to statements made during the call. No unexpected delays to ongoing clinical or regulatory timelines were disclosed during the management discussion segment, with leadership noting that all ongoing programs remain on track as previously communicated to market participants.

Forward Guidance
ARS Pharmaceuticals did not issue formal revenue guidance for upcoming periods, a common practice for pre-commercial biotech firms facing uncertainty around regulatory approval timelines. Management did note that operating expenses could rise slightly in the near term if the company moves forward with pre-launch commercial preparation activities, including building out a specialized sales force, investing in healthcare provider education materials, and scaling manufacturing capacity to support potential product launch. Leadership cautioned that all pre-launch spending plans are contingent on receiving positive regulatory feedback, and that there is no fixed timeline for potential commercialization of its lead candidate at this stage. The company also noted that it may explore additional strategic partnerships to support commercialization efforts if it makes sense for long-term shareholder value, though no concrete partnership talks were confirmed during the call.

Market Reaction
Following the release of the previous quarter earnings results, trading in SPRY shares saw below-average volume in recent sessions, with limited price volatility observed through the first week post-release. Market analysts covering the biotech sector noted that the quarterly results were largely priced in by investors, as the primary catalyst for future valuation shifts for ARS Pharmaceuticals remains the upcoming regulatory decision on its lead product candidate, rather than pre-revenue quarterly operating metrics. Some sell-side analysts have highlighted that the narrower-than-projected quarterly loss signals that the company’s cash burn management is more efficient than some market participants had previously anticipated, though this observation has not led to widespread revisions to analyst outlooks for the stock as of this analysis. Market participants are expected to continue focusing on regulatory updates as the primary driver of trading activity for SPRY shares in the coming months.
